`CLAIMS
`
`Whatis claimedis:
`
`l,
`
`A luminaire, comprising:
`
`a heat spreader and a heat sink thermally coupled to and disposed diametrically
`
`outboard of the heat spreader;
`
`an outer optic securely retained relative to at least one of the heat spreader and the
`
`heat sink; and
`
`a light source disposed in thermal communication with the heat spreader, the light
`
`source comprising a pl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s);
`
`wherein the heat spreader, the heat sink and the outer optic, in combination, have
`
`an overall height H and an overall outside dimension D suchthat the ratio of H/D is equal
`
`to or less than 0,25;
`
`wherein the combination defined by the heat spreader, the heat sink and the outer
`
`optic, is so dimensioned as to: cover an opening defined by a nominally sized four-inch
`
`can light fixture; and, cover an opening defined by a nominally sized four-inch electrical
`
`junction box.
`
`2,
`
`The luminaire of Claim 1, wherein:
`
`the heat spreader and the heat sink are integrally formed such that a heat flow path
`
`from the light source through the heat spreader to the heat sink is continuous and
`
`uninterrupted,
